Holtefjellet
Holtefjellet is a cliff in Åseral Municipality, Agder and has an elevation of 422 metres. Holtefjellet is situated nearby to the locality Roseland, as well as near the hamlet Rosseland.Places of Interest

Kyrkjebygda or Kyrkjebygdi is the administrative centre of Åseral municipality in Agder county, Norway. The village is located on a small flat plain in a valley at the northern end of the lake Øre at the confluence of the rivers Logna and Monn. Kyrkjebygda is situated 10 km south of Holtefjellet.
